The Valentine Lines by T.K. Sheffield
Cupid swaps arrow for scones in a magical screwball comedy perfect for Valentine's Day! 💖

The Valentine Lines reimagines Cupid—aka Bart McGee—as an underdog ditching the corporate grind of Mt. Olympus, Inc., for small-town life in quaint Mineral Point, Wisconsin. When Bart launches a matchmaking business and falls in love with a local baker, chaos ensues as his meddling Olympus relatives crash the scene. It’s packed with snappy banter, slapstick escapades, mythological mishaps, and thoughtful explorations of love, trust, and self-discovery. It’s a light, literary escape for readers craving whimsy with emotional resonance.
